Here’s what happened with Drew McIntyre, Randy Orton & Riddle after WrestleMania Backlash went off the air.
In the main event of the show, Roman Reigns & The Usos defeated the team of Drew McIntyre & RK-Bro, with Reigns pinning Riddle for the victory.
After the cameras stopped rolling, McIntyre, Orton and Riddle posed together in the ring, with Orton striking a pose with McIntyre’s sword.
Randy handed the sword back to McIntyre, who didn’t let Riddle hold his prize possession.
